Mitsubishi UFJ Capital

Mitsubishi UFJ Capital is a venture capital firm based in Tokyo, with additional offices in Osaka and Nagoya, founded in 1974. It concentrates on seed to development stage and startup investments across healthcare, biotech, information technology, electronics, high technology, life sciences, fintech, ICT, SaaS, and AI sectors. The firm targets opportunities in Japan and with relevance to the Japanese market, and it participates in investment syndication for Japanese investments to support entrepreneurs and innovation within the domestic economy.

Secai Marche

Series A in 2024
Secai Marche is a platform that connects farmers, chefs, and consumers to source and deliver farm-direct ingredients. It enables restaurants to purchase high-quality products directly from farmers, offering end-to-end services such as sourcing, order processing, payment, and delivery. Through its Secai Marche and sanchoku offerings, the platform delivers seasonal, regionally sourced ingredients while helping small-scale farms access markets and achieve profitable sales. Founded in 2018 and based in Tokyo with an additional location in Kuala Lumpur, the company operates globally to promote economically viable, sustainable farming. By simplifying procurement and logistics, the platform supports farmers’ livelihoods and strengthens local supply chains for restaurants seeking fresh, traceable ingredients.

Vivid Garden

Series C in 2022
Vivid Garden Inc. is an agriculture company based in Minato, Japan, founded in 2016. It operates as an online marketplace that connects producers with consumers and restaurants, enabling direct sales of farm products, ingredients, and flowers. The company manages several platforms, including Tabe Choku, which facilitates consumer-to-consumer sales of agricultural products, and Tabe Choku Pro, a specialized service for restaurants to order ingredients. Additionally, Vivid Garden offers Eat Chok, a platform designed to support farmers in delivering their products to office locations. Through these initiatives, Vivid Garden aims to streamline the distribution of fresh produce while enhancing access for both consumers and businesses.

Ginkan

Series A in 2020
Ginkan, Inc. is a Tokyo-based company founded in 2015 that specializes in developing blockchain technology-based platforms. The company operates SynchroLife, a platform that tokenizes restaurant reviews and rewards users with cryptocurrency for their quality contributions. Additionally, Ginkan offers Festar, a dating application. The firm focuses on integrating artificial intelligence and blockchain technology to enhance user experiences, particularly in the restaurant and social sectors, by providing tailored recommendations based on user activities and reviews.
